Nginx简单部署前端打包项目
下载Nginx文件
1.windows 版本下载地址 http://nginx.org/en/download.html
2.Linux版本下载地址 http://nginx.org/download/
一、windows部署
主要修改配置文件 nginx-1.18.0/conf/nginx.conf
Nginx启动
配置后直接点击Nginx.exe或者在nginx安装路径 运行cmd命令****start nginx
二、Linux部署
需要使用的工具Xftp和Xshell
将下载好的文件使用Xftp传输到linux上
解压文件
tar -zxvf nginx-1.9.9.tar.gz
配置nginx运行环境
1.安装gcc
yum install gcc-c++
2.安装PCRE pcre-devel正则式语法库
yum install -y pcre pcre-devel
3.安装zlib
yum install -y zlib zlib-devel
4.安装open ssl
yum install -y openssl openssl-devel
5.安装nginx
进入nginx解压目录
执行./configure文件
./configure
执行完后执行以下操作
make
如果出错则查看前四个包是否安装成功,可能需要换源。
没出错继续运行
make install
后返回上层目录会出现几个目录,进入nginx目录
修改nginx配置文件
vim /usr/local/nginx/conf/nginx.conf
修改保存后,返回安装目录
如果包以下错误
lsof -i:80命令查看80端口是否占用
lsof -i:80
如果占用的不需要的进程可以直接 kill 掉,在运行nginx即可。
linux环境下nginx命令和windows差不多
nginx 的一些基础命令
功能 | WIN | LINUX(sbin目录下) |
---|---|---|
启动 | start nginx | ./nginx |
关闭nginx | nginx -s quit/stop | ./nginx -s quit/stop |
重启nginx | nginx -s reload | ./nginx -s reload |
重启日志 | nginx -s reopen | ./nginx -s reopen |